Why do we need the money?

Well to organise for just one person to ride for one session costs us approximately £17.

How much we here you cry? Yes it really does cost that much, that’s because for each of these sessions we must pay for 

  • hire of the horse or pony (including its tack)
  • hire of the Instructor
  • hire of the Arena
  • provision of hard hat, Wellingtons and waterproofs if required
  • insurance

To be honest the list above is just the basics, if you can imagine multiplying the above cost by all the happy people who ride each year, then adding in all the other hidden costs such as electricity, telephone, administrators wages, competition fees, new equipment, need we go on???

Seriously though, our Group members have a lot of fun but it does cost an ever increasing amount of money each year as the groups expands and prices rise annually – the good news is you can help!
